Understanding Lip Implants

Lip implants are a cosmetic procedure that involves the insertion of a small, solid implant into the lips to enhance their volume and shape. This procedure can be particularly beneficial for individuals who feel their lips are too thin or lack definition. The implants are typically made of safe, biocompatible materials, such as silicone or pol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E), and are designed to provide a natural-looking and long-lasting result.

The Pain Factor

One of the primary concerns for those considering lip implants in Port Moresby is the level of discomfort or pain involved. The good news is that the procedure is generally well-tolerated, with most patients reporting only mild to moderate discomfort during the process. The level of pain can vary depending on several factors, including the individual's pain tolerance, the expertise of the surgeon, and the specific techniques used. During the procedure, the surgeon will typically use local anesthesia to numb the treatment area, minimizing any significant discomfort. After the surgery, some swelling and bruising are common, but these typically subside within a few days to a week. It's important to note that the recovery process and the extent of any discomfort can also be influenced by the individual's adherence to the post-operative care instructions provided by the surgeon. Proper follow-up and diligent wound care can help ensure a smooth and comfortable recovery.

FAQs

1. **How long does the lip implant procedure take?** The lip implant procedure typically takes between 30 to 60 minutes, depending on the complexity of the case and the surgeon's experience. 2. **How long does the recovery process take?** The recovery process can vary, but most patients can expect to see significant improvement in their appearance within a week or two. Swelling and bruising may persist for up to a month, but they typically subside within the first few days. 3. **Are lip implants safe?** Lip implants are generally considered safe when performed by a qualified and experienced plastic surgeon. However, as with any surgical procedure, there are potential risks, such as infection, implant rejection, or changes in sensation. Your surgeon will discuss these risks with you during your consultation. 4. **How long do lip implants last?** Lip implants are designed to be a long-lasting solution, with most lasting for many years. However, it's important to note that the longevity of the implants can be affected by factors such as the patient's age, skin type, and lifestyle.
